PremiumPremium


Datacenter cartoon composition with indoor view of data analysts working place with desktop computer and servers illustration
macrovector- cloud hosting
- cloud storage
- cloud server
- cloud software
- cloud computing
- cloud services
- server
- datacenter
- computer networking
- computer service
- hosting
- cloud tech
- cloud network
- service
- cable
- professional services
- technician
- cluster
- supporter
- computer hardware
- wire
- hardware
- connect
- network
- communication
- hard work
- software
- work
- control
- job
- electronics
- cartoon
- computer work
- cartoon character
- computer software